An Overview of Lidocaine Factories


Lidocaine is a widely used local anesthetic and antiarrhythmic agent that plays a crucial role in both medical and dental procedures. As a key pharmaceutical product, the production of lidocaine is an essential component of the healthcare industry. The process occurs within specialized facilities known as lidocaine factories. These factories focus on the synthesis, formulation, and quality control of lidocaine, ensuring that the final product meets stringent safety and efficacy standards.


The production of lidocaine begins with the careful selection of raw materials. Basic chemical compounds are utilized, and these must undergo various chemical reactions to yield lidocaine. The processes often include halogenation, alkylation, and amide synthesis. Each reaction is conducted under controlled conditions to ensure precision and prevent contamination. Quality control is paramount at this stage, as the purity of the raw materials directly influences the quality of the final product.


Lidocaine factories employ advanced technologies and equipment to streamline production. High-performance liquid chromatography (HPLC) and gas chromatography (GC) are often used to analyze the chemical composition of the solutions at different stages of production. These technologies ensure that any impurities are detected and eliminated, ultimately safeguarding the health and safety of patients who will receive lidocaine injections or topicals.

In addition to production, lidocaine factories also place a strong emphasis on regulatory compliance. The pharmaceutical industry is governed by strict regulations laid out by organizations such as the Food and Drug Administration (FDA) in the United States and the European Medicines Agency (EMA) in Europe. Factories must adhere to Good Manufacturing Practices (GMP) to maintain high-quality production standards. Regular inspections and audits are conducted to verify compliance and to ensure that every batch of lidocaine produced meets safety and efficacy requirements.


As demand for lidocaine continues to grow, particularly in developing countries and among aging populations, the need for efficient and scalable manufacturing processes becomes increasingly important. Advancements in technology and production methodologies are being explored to improve yield and reduce costs, ensuring that lidocaine remains accessible to healthcare providers and patients alike.


In summary, lidocaine factories are integral to the pharmaceutical industry, providing a vital product that is essential in a variety of medical settings. Through rigorous quality control, adherence to stringent regulations, and continual advancements in manufacturing practices, these factories help ensure that lidocaine is safe, effective, and widely available for use.
